The Staffing and Labor Economics Facing Spanish Fork Government Administration
Like many mid-size municipalities in Utah, Spanish Fork faces significant pressure from a tightening labor market. As the region experiences rapid growth, the competition for skilled administrative, technical, and public works talent has intensified, driving up wage expectations. According to recent industry reports, local governments are seeing a 10-15% increase in personnel costs as they compete with the private sector for top-tier talent. This labor shortage is not merely a budgetary concern but an operational bottleneck that limits the city's ability to scale services. With a staff of approximately 190, the city must maximize the output of its current workforce to maintain the high quality of life residents expect. Relying on traditional hiring to meet growing demand is increasingly unsustainable, making the adoption of efficiency-driving technologies a strategic necessity to manage labor costs while maintaining service excellence.

Automated Citizen Inquiry and Service Request Routing
Government staff are frequently overwhelmed by repetitive inquiries regarding utility bills, permit statuses, and public works requests. For a mid-sized municipality like Spanish Fork, these inquiries consume significant time that could be better spent on complex policy or infrastructure projects. AI agents can act as the first point of contact, ensuring that citizens receive instant, accurate information while filtering out routine requests, thereby reducing the burden on administrative personnel and improving overall community satisfaction scores.
AI-Driven Permit Application Review and Validation
The permitting process is a critical bottleneck for economic development. Manual review of applications for zoning compliance and building codes is time-intensive and prone to human error. By automating the preliminary review phase, the city can accelerate development timelines for local businesses and residents. This increases efficiency, ensures consistent application of municipal codes, and allows planning staff to focus on high-level urban design and complex variance hearings rather than administrative data entry.
Predictive Maintenance for Public Infrastructure Assets
Reactive maintenance is significantly more expensive than proactive care. For Spanish Fork’s public works department, managing aging infrastructure requires precise resource allocation. AI agents can analyze sensor data from utility meters and street infrastructure to predict failures before they occur. This shift from reactive to predictive maintenance preserves capital budgets, extends the lifespan of city assets, and prevents service disruptions for residents, aligning with the city's goal of maintaining an outstanding quality of life.
Automated Financial Compliance and Audit Preparation
Government entities face stringent regulatory requirements and the constant need for transparent financial reporting. Manual reconciliation of departmental budgets and procurement records is labor-intensive and creates audit risks. AI agents can provide continuous monitoring of financial transactions, ensuring all expenditures align with municipal policy and state transparency laws. This reduces the risk of non-compliance, simplifies the year-end audit process, and provides the city manager with real-time visibility into fiscal health.
Dynamic Scheduling for Parks and Recreation Facilities
Managing facility usage for a growing community requires complex scheduling to balance public access, private rentals, and maintenance windows. Manual scheduling often leads to conflicts, underutilization, or administrative overhead. AI agents can optimize facility usage based on demand patterns, seasonal trends, and staff availability. This maximizes revenue from facility rentals, improves public access, and ensures that maintenance crews have dedicated, uninterrupted windows to keep parks and recreation facilities in top condition.
